内容概要:本文详细阐述了智能招聘Boss平台的系统架构设计,基于实在智能设计器、Python、LangChain、DeepSeek和Chroma构建自动化招聘解决方案。系统采用“四层一引擎”架构,涵盖交互层、业务流程层、AI引擎层和数据层,实现岗位发布、候选人沟通、面试预约与反馈等全流程自动化。通过状态识别、动态Prompt组装、知识检索增强与结构化回复生成,提升AI对话的准确性与可控性,确保招聘流程高效闭环。; 适合人群:具备一定Python编程基础和AI应用理解能力的技术人员、RPA开发者、AI产品经理及招聘系统设计相关人员;适合从事智能化人力资源系统研发的1-3年经验工程师。; 使用场景及目标:① 实现Boss直聘平台上的自动岗位发布与候选人互动;② 基于意图识别与状态机驱动的智能对话调度;③ 利用向量数据库与大模型提升回复质量与知识一致性;④ 构建可审计、可追溯、低风险的AI招聘流程。; 阅读建议:建议结合Chroma、LangChain与DeepSeek的实际部署环境进行实践,重点关注Prompt动态组装、上下文压缩与风控机制的设计逻辑,并配合业务流程图调试各模块协同效果。
2026-04-23 03:56:32 7.27MB Python Chroma MySQL
1
标题Python餐饮外卖平台数据分析与可视化系统设计与实现AI更换标题第1章引言介绍餐饮外卖行业背景、数据分析与可视化的重要性及论文的研究目的和意义。1.1研究背景与意义阐述餐饮外卖行业的发展现状和数据分析与可视化的必要性。1.2国内外研究现状概述国内外在餐饮外卖平台数据分析与可视化方面的研究情况。1.3论文方法与创新点简述本文采用的研究方法和系统设计的创新之处。第2章相关理论与技术介绍数据分析、可视化及Python编程语言的相关理论和技术。2.1数据分析基本理论阐述数据分析的基本概念、流程和方法。2.2数据可视化技术介绍数据可视化的原理、常用工具和实现方法。2.3Python编程语言与库简述Python的特点及其在数据分析和可视化方面的应用,介绍相关库和工具。第3章系统需求分析与设计对餐饮外卖平台数据分析与可视化系统进行需求分析和设计。3.1系统需求分析分析系统的功能需求、性能需求和安全性需求。3.2系统架构设计设计系统的整体架构,包括前后端分离、数据库设计等。3.3系统功能模块设计详细设计系统的各个功能模块,如数据采集、数据处理、数据分析、数据可视化等。第4章系统实现与测试详细介绍系统的实现过程,并对系统进行测试。4.1系统实现阐述系统的具体实现过程,包括代码编写、模块集成等。4.2系统测试对系统进行功能测试、性能测试和安全性测试,确保系统的稳定性和可用性。第5章数据分析与可视化应用实例通过具体的应用实例展示系统的数据分析与可视化功能。5.1数据采集与预处理介绍数据采集的来源、方法和预处理过程。5.2数据分析方法与应用阐述数据分析的具体方法及其在餐饮外卖平台的应用实例。5.3数据可视化展示与分析展示数据可视化的结果,并对其进行分析和解读。第6章结论与展望总结论文的研究成果,并展望未来的研究方向和应用前景。6.1研究结论概括论文的主要研究结论和系统的特点与优势。6.2研究
2026-04-22 13:39:58 127.36MB python django spider mysql
1
【PHP淘宝客网站源码】是一个基于PHP编程语言构建的电子商务平台,主要目的是为用户提供一个可以获取淘宝联盟商品信息、推广并赚取佣金的系统。这个源码是开发者或者站长用于搭建自己的淘宝客网站的基础,它包含了从用户注册、登录、浏览商品、生成推广链接到跟踪订单和佣金结算等一系列功能的实现。 在PHP编程语言中,淘宝客网站源码通常会涉及到以下几个关键知识点: 1. **框架应用**:大多数PHP项目会使用如Laravel、ThinkPHP、Yii等框架来提高开发效率和代码的可维护性。这些框架提供了丰富的功能,如路由管理、模型-视图-控制器(MVC)架构、数据库操作以及安全防护等。 2. **数据库设计**:为了存储用户信息、商品数据、订单状态等,源码会包含与MySQL或其它关系型数据库交互的代码。常见的数据库设计可能包括用户表、商品表、订单表、佣金表等。 3. **API接口集成**:淘宝客网站的核心在于获取淘宝联盟的商品数据和订单信息,这需要通过调用淘宝联盟提供的API接口实现。开发者需要理解API的使用规范,如认证机制、请求参数、响应格式等。 4. **用户认证与权限控制**:源码会实现用户注册、登录功能,并且可能会有权限控制系统,如不同用户角色(普通用户、管理员)对网站功能的访问权限差异。 5. **模板引擎**:为了实现动态页面渲染,源码中会使用模板引擎(如Smarty、Twig等),将PHP逻辑与HTML分离,提升页面的可读性和可维护性。 6. **前端技术**:网站的前端通常会使用HTML、CSS和JavaScript进行开发,可能结合Bootstrap、Vue.js、jQuery等库或框架来实现交互效果和响应式布局。 7. **安全措施**:为了防止SQL注入、XSS攻击等安全问题,源码中需要包含相应的防护措施,如使用预处理语句、过滤用户输入、开启CSRF防护等。 8. **佣金计算与结算**:源码会有一套佣金计算逻辑,根据淘宝联盟的规则,跟踪用户通过推广链接产生的订单,然后计算并显示应得的佣金。 9. **日志记录**:为了方便问题排查和运营分析,源码中可能会有日志记录功能,记录用户的操作、系统异常等信息。 10. **SEO优化**:为了提高网站的搜索引擎排名,源码可能包含SEO优化的元素,如自定义元标签、URL重写、Sitemap生成等。 11. **支付集成**:若网站提供在线支付功能,会涉及到第三方支付平台的API集成,如支付宝、微信支付等。 12. **缓存机制**:为了提高网站性能,可能采用缓存技术(如Redis、Memcached)来存储频繁访问的数据。 "PHP淘宝客网站源码"是一个包含多种技术层面的项目,涵盖了从后端开发到前端展示,从数据交互到安全防护的完整流程。对于开发者来说,理解和掌握这些知识点是成功部署和维护此类网站的关键。
2026-04-22 09:01:39 53.7MB
1
在PHP开发中,模板引擎是一种常见的工具,它用于将业务逻辑和显示逻辑分离,使得开发者可以专注于编写PHP代码处理数据,而设计师则可以专心于HTML布局和样式设计。本项目提供了一个最轻量级的PHP模板引擎,旨在解决一些大型模板引擎过于复杂或效率不高的问题,满足对简单模板解析的需求。 `xt.class.php` 是这个轻量级模板引擎的核心类文件。在这个文件中,我们可以预见到包含了模板解析和执行的关键功能。通常,此类会包含如解析PHP标签、变量替换、控制结构(如循环和条件判断)处理等方法。通过实例化这个类,我们可以加载并渲染模板文件,将PHP变量注入到HTML模板中。 `test.php` 文件可能是测试这个模板引擎的示例代码。在该文件中,开发者可能展示了如何初始化模板引擎,设置变量,以及渲染模板的过程。这可以帮助我们理解如何在实际项目中使用这个轻量级引擎,例如,加载模板文件,赋值给模板变量,然后调用渲染方法输出最终的HTML。 `template` 文件夹通常用于存放模板文件。在这个项目中,它可能包含了一些基本的HTML模板,这些模板使用了特定的语法来插入PHP变量和控制结构。模板引擎会读取这些文件,解析其中的特殊标记,并用实际的数据替换它们。这种分离使得HTML模板可以独立于PHP代码进行修改和优化,提高开发效率。 `tcache` 文件夹可能是缓存目录,模板引擎在解析模板后可能会将编译后的结果存储在这里。使用缓存可以显著提高模板的渲染速度,因为后续的请求可以直接加载已编译的版本,而不是每次都重新解析模板。对于高流量的网站,这种缓存机制是必不可少的。 轻量级PHP模板引擎的亮点在于其简洁性和高效性。它可能只包含基础的模板语法,如变量插入、控制结构,没有过多的复杂特性,适合那些只需要基础模板功能的小型项目或者对性能有较高要求的场景。通过使用这样的模板引擎,开发者可以在不牺牲性能的前提下,实现代码和视图的分离,提升项目的可维护性和团队协作效率。
2026-04-21 11:58:51 3KB PHP模板
1
在电子工程领域,单片机是微控制器的一种,它们在各种设备中扮演着核心角色,控制着硬件操作。HT单片机是由台湾合泰半导体(HT Micro)制造的一系列低功耗、高性能的微控制器,广泛应用在消费电子、工业控制、智能家居等领域。当面临串行通信需求时,但单片机的物理串口资源不足,就需要利用软件技术来模拟串口,这就是“HT单片机 模拟串口”这一主题的核心。 串行通信是一种数据传输方式,它将数据一位一位地传输,通常比并行通信更节省硬件资源。在许多HT单片机中,可能只有一个或两个物理UART(通用异步收发传输器),这在需要连接多个外部设备或者进行大量串行通信时可能会显得不够用。为了解决这个问题,工程师可以通过编程手段在单片机内部创建一个或多个虚拟串口,这种方法称为模拟串口。 模拟串口的实现主要依赖于单片机的GPIO(通用输入/输出)引脚和定时器。通过设置GPIO引脚模拟发送和接收线,然后使用定时器来控制波特率。波特率是衡量串口数据传输速率的参数,9600波特表示每秒传输9600位。在8,1,N的配置中,“8”指的是每个数据帧有8位数据,“1”表示没有奇偶校验位,“N”意味着无停止位,这是一种常见的串口通信格式。 模拟串口的过程大致如下: 1. 初始化:设置GPIO引脚为输入/输出模式,并配置定时器。 2. 波特率设定:根据9600波特率的要求,调整定时器的预分频器和计数器值,使得定时器溢出周期与所需波特率相符。 3. 发送数据:当需要发送数据时,将数据位逐位输出到模拟的TX引脚,并在适当时间间隔后发送下一位。 4. 接收数据:通过检测模拟RX引脚的电平变化,捕获接收的数据位。 5. 帧同步和错误检查:为了确保数据的正确传输,需要添加合适的起始位、停止位和可能的校验位,并对帧同步和错误进行检测。 文件"10.模拟串口"可能包含了实现这个过程的详细代码示例、设计原理图、步骤解释以及相关的开发工具和库的使用说明。通过学习这些资料,开发者可以深入了解如何在HT单片机上创建并使用模拟串口,以满足更多串行通信需求。 模拟串口技术极大地扩展了HT单片机的串行通信能力,使开发者能够在资源有限的情况下实现多路串行通信,这对于嵌入式系统的设计和应用具有重要意义。同时,这也体现了软硬件结合的设计理念,即通过软件编程来弥补硬件的局限,提高了系统的灵活性和实用性。
2026-04-20 22:22:33 18KB HT合泰单片机 模拟串口
1
在本示例中,我们探讨了如何在PHP中使用单例模式来模拟Java Bean的实现。让我们深入了解单例模式和Java Bean的概念。 单例模式是一种设计模式,确保一个类只有一个实例,并提供一个全局访问点。这样可以控制类的实例化过程,特别是在资源管理或者需要共享状态的情况下。在PHP中,我们通过私有构造函数和静态方法来实现单例模式,以防止外部直接创建对象实例。在`Php_bean`类中,我们看到`__construct()`方法被声明为私有,防止直接实例化。同时,定义了一个静态私有变量`$_instance`来存储单例实例。 `Php_bean`类模拟了Java Bean,Java Bean是一种符合一定规范的Java类,通常用于封装数据和业务逻辑。在这个例子中,`Php_bean`拥有属性如`hit`(命中次数)、`array`(缓存)和`itratorCount`(迭代次数),以及对应的方法如`add_hit()`、`get_hit()`、`add_itratorCount()`、`get_itratorCount()`、`set_cache()`和`get_cache()`。这些方法和属性使得`Php_bean`类具有了类似于Java Bean的数据封装和行为特性。 `get_value()`函数是实现杨辉三角形的递归算法,它利用了`Php_bean`类的缓存机制。当需要计算特定行和列的值时,先尝试从缓存中获取,如果不存在则通过递归调用自身计算,然后将结果存入缓存。这提高了算法效率,避免了重复计算。递归函数在处理杨辉三角形时,会根据行和列的关系来计算当前值,如果列大于行或行小于0,返回0;如果行和列相等,返回1;对于其他情况,递归计算上一行相邻两个位置的值之和。 在实际应用中,单例模式和Java Bean的模拟有助于减少系统资源的消耗,提高性能,尤其是在处理大量数据或需要全局状态时。例如,`Php_bean`可以作为一个缓存系统,存储计算过的杨辉三角形值,减少后续请求的计算时间。 代码展示了如何使用`Php_bean`的静态方法`instance()`获取单例实例,以及如何调用`get_value()`函数来计算特定位置的杨辉三角形值。通过打印`hit`次数,可以看到缓存机制的使用情况,这有助于优化算法的执行效率。 这个示例展示了如何在PHP中结合单例模式、Java Bean概念以及递归函数,解决实际问题,提高代码的可维护性和性能。理解并掌握这些编程技巧对提升PHP开发能力至关重要。
2026-04-17 13:14:32 92KB 单例模式 Java Bean
1
易语言MYSQL连接池模块源码 系统结构:GetThis,初始化,关闭类线程,线程_测试,其他_附加文本,连接池初始化,取mysql句柄,释放mysql句柄,取空闲句柄数,销毁连接池,取_类_函数地址,取指针内容
2026-04-16 21:55:24 7KB 易语言MYSQL连接池模块源码
1
MySQL 6.0数据库安装包是一个为用户提供高效数据存储解决方案的软件,尤其适用于中小型企业或个人网站。MySQL因其开源、免费、稳定和高性能的特点,在IT领域广泛应用。此安装包包括了MySQL 6.0版本的数据库服务器,以及安装手册,方便用户按照指导进行安装和配置。 MySQL是一个关系型数据库管理系统(RDBMS),它支持SQL标准,能够处理大量数据并提供高可用性和可扩展性。多线程特性使得MySQL在处理并发请求时表现优秀,可以同时服务于多个用户而不会影响系统性能。这使得MySQL在高并发的Web应用中成为首选数据库。 MySQL 6.0版本是该系列的一个重要里程碑,它引入了一些关键的改进和新特性,例如: 1. **InnoDB存储引擎的增强**:InnoDB是MySQL中最常用的事务处理存储引擎,提供了ACID(原子性、一致性、隔离性和持久性)事务支持。在6.0版本中,InnoDB可能有性能优化和更多的并发控制改进。 2. **分区功能**:MySQL 6.0引入了表分区,允许用户将大表分成更小、更易管理的部分,从而提高查询性能和管理效率。 3. **触发器**:这是数据库对象,允许在特定操作(如INSERT、UPDATE或DELETE)之后自动执行指定的SQL语句,增强了数据完整性和业务逻辑的实施。 4. **存储过程**:预编译的SQL代码集合,可以在需要时重复执行,提高了代码复用和效率。 5. **更好的复制功能**:MySQL的复制功能在6.0中可能有所增强,允许数据在多个服务器之间同步,提供高可用性和灾难恢复选项。 6. **性能优化**:包括查询缓存的改进和优化查询执行的算法,使得数据检索速度更快。 安装过程中,`mysql-essential-6.0.11-alpha-winx64.msi` 文件是Windows 64位系统的安装程序,用户可以通过这个文件来安装MySQL服务器。安装手册将详细指导用户如何配置服务器、创建数据库、设置用户权限等步骤,对于初学者来说非常有用。 另外,压缩包中的`.url`文件可能是链接到相关资源的快捷方式,比如“去脚本之家看看.url”可能指向一个提供编程教程或资源的网站,“领取天猫淘宝内部优惠券.url”和“服务器软件.url”则可能是与数据库安装无关的促销链接或服务器软件资源推荐。 MySQL 6.0数据库安装包提供了全面的功能,适合那些需要可靠、高性能数据库服务的用户。通过详细的安装手册,用户可以轻松地在自己的系统上部署和管理MySQL服务器,从而充分利用其强大的数据库管理能力。
2026-04-16 10:10:09 43.45MB mysql
1
MySQL是一款执行性能非常高的小型数据库管理系统,也是网站存储经常用到的数据库系统,该体积小巧,配置方便,速度快可以说是非常主流的一个选择,小编提供的MySQL6.0包含了32位和64位版本,新版本优化了SQL查贸易算法,支持多线程,并且提供了强大的中文支持,小编还为大家整理了安装图解,有需要的用户快快下载吧。
2026-04-16 10:04:29 86.79MB mysql6.0
1
《wap手机订单系统:构建高效移动端营销利器》 在当今移动互联网时代,手机已经成为人们日常生活中不可或缺的一部分。针对这一趋势,企业纷纷寻求构建适合手机用户的订单系统,以便更好地吸引并服务消费者。"wap手机订单系统"就是这样一款专为百度竞价产品推广设计的PHP源码,旨在提升线上交易的便捷性和效率。 这款订单系统的亮点在于其“单页产品”设计,它将整个购买流程集成在一个页面内,减少了用户在不同页面间的跳转,从而降低了购物车放弃率,提高了转化率。用户只需浏览商品、填写信息、支付,即可完成购买,大大提升了用户体验。 系统支持“百度竞价”,这意味着它具备与百度广告平台的深度整合能力。通过精准投放,企业可以将广告推送给目标用户,吸引他们点击进入订单页面,进一步提高营销效果。同时,百度竞价的实时反馈数据可以帮助企业优化广告策略,提升广告投入产出比。 源码中包含两套“wap端模板”,一套简洁明了,另一套可能更具特色或个性化。这样的设计考虑到了不同用户群体的喜好,企业可以根据自身品牌形象和目标受众选择合适的模板,或者结合两套模板的优势进行定制,以达到最佳视觉效果和交互体验。 此订单系统基于PHP开发,PHP是一种广泛使用的开源服务器端脚本语言,尤其适合Web开发。它的灵活性、易用性和丰富的库支持,使得开发快速、高效。同时,PHP有着庞大的开发者社区,遇到问题时可以轻易获取帮助和解决方案。 此外,源码的提供意味着企业可以自行修改和扩展功能,根据业务需求进行定制化开发。这不仅降低了对外部服务的依赖,也为企业未来的升级和维护提供了更大的自主权。 “wap手机订单系统”是一款集便捷、高效、可定制于一体的订单管理系统,它结合了百度竞价的营销优势和移动设备的普及性,是企业提升线上销售业绩的重要工具。通过合理运用,企业可以打造出极具竞争力的移动端推广页面,从而在激烈的市场竞争中占据一席之地。
2026-04-12 11:50:12 552KB 手机模板
1